From the rear cover
In this widely praised and accessible work, Claude Levi-Strauss examines the rich mythology of American Indians and illustrates how centuries of contact with Europeans have altered the tales. Levi-Strauss focuses on the opposition between Wild Cat and Coyote, two figures in a Nez Perce myth, to explore the meaning and uses of gemellarity, or twinness, in Native American mythology.
